Here are Brandon’s suggestions of what how to position Mineral Air for a man.

 

Don’t think of it as makeup but a problem skin solver.

“Many men balk at the idea of using makeup,” says Brandon, “and with good reason. But the reality of Mineral Air is that your skin still looks like skin . . . just a better version of it. So just call it a ‘skin system’ and you’re good to go.”

 

 

Take the shine off oily skin.

“For men with overly oily skin, shine is a definite problem,” says Brandon. “That’s where Mineral Air’s Setting Mattifier works so well. Used by itself in the AirMist device, a light weightless coat can neutralize the oil and leave oily faces looking grease-free for 12 hours at a time.”  

 

 

Even things out on Zoom.

Brandon notes, “Zoom cameras can highlight flaws even when they’re not easily discernable in person. In addition to a ring light, a Mineral Air system can make faces look healthier and more even. The key is to match the color to the skin. The best way to do this is to go outdoors in natural light, mist on a light coat and look in a mirror. If you’ve ordered a color that doesn’t match exactly, Mineral Air will exchange it for one that does for no charge.”

 

 

Rescue your post-party face.

Even in lockdown, people are still going to celebrating the holidays with food, drink and very little sleep during the season. A misting of Mineral Air Four-in-One Foundation can even out dark circles, brighten an ashy pallor and neutralize red blotchiness all without. your guy looking like he’s wearing makeup.

 

 

Touch up with beard- and whisker-friendly spot correction.

“The AirMist device is a precision instrument,” says Brandon. “Applying Four-in-One will not muck up a beard and 5 o’clock shadow if you’re not aiming that way. But should some of the pigment get onto a beard, it will easily wipe off with no trace.”

What’s the difference?

Mineral Air offers two device-plus-formula categories, one for makeup, the other for skincare. 
Mineral Air original (MA) includes its AirMist Device, an easy to use, everyday consumer tool that rivals professional airbrushing in its cosmetic application of our eponymous foundation, blush, or bronzer. 
Mineral Air Skin (MAS) features the Renewal Serum System with its ElixerMist Device for lightweight vaporized delivery.
